    Wall Street looks set to rebound as U.S. stock futures rally after Trump delays E.U. tariff deadline

    Wall Street appears poised to surge when markets open Tuesday, after two days of rallies by U.S. stock futures, spurred by President Donald Trump delaying his latest threat of 50% tariffs against European Union imports until July 9, to allow more time to reach a trade deal.
